In-Depth Analysis

Background

Manchester United's post-season tour has been met with mixed reactions. Following a 1-0 defeat to ASEAN All-Stars, the team faces Hong Kong amid concerns over player fatigue. The tour, estimated to generate £8 million, highlights the financial pressures on top clubs to maximize revenue, even at the expense of player welfare. Ashley Westwood's comments reflect a broader debate about the demands placed on modern footballers.

Team News and Strategy

Ruben Amorim confirmed that Harry Maguire, Diogo Dalot, and Andre Onana will miss the game due to promotional activities in India. Luke Shaw is also out. Amorim aims to balance the team, giving young players a chance while respecting the fans who bought tickets. The match provides a platform for players like Alejandro Garnacho and Bruno Fernandes to showcase their abilities.

How to Watch

The match will be broadcast on MUTV, requiring a paid subscription (£7.99/$10.79 per month or £29.99/$40.50 per year). Live updates and team news will be available on the official Man Utd app for those without a subscription.
